GRPH 101 — History of Graphic Design and Visual Communication
A survey of the evolution of graphic design and visual communication from 1450 to the present in Europe and the United States. The course will cover the significant events and works in media, graphic design, and visual communication, and will contextualize design history in terms of artistic achievement, technical innovation, and cultural expression. The course will identify and discuss graphic design and visual communication from the medieval period through the digital age.
